Jewell can stay for as long as he likes


By Alan G
October 8 2006

Paul Jewell has been told by Chairman Dave Whelan that he has a “job for life” at Wigan Athletic after signing a contract extension, committing himself to the club until 2010.

“Paul Jewell is here for as long as he wants to stay” said Whelan.

 

"He has committed himself to the club for another four years. We're delighted with that because as far as we're concerned he is simply the best.

 

"If a big club came in for him and it was what he wanted, then I'd shake his hand, thank him for what he had done for Wigan Athletic, and I'd wish the guy all the best for the future.

"He is too good a man to hold back and our partnership is too good for that.

"He's an absolute pleasure to work with. But I have this fear that another club will come in for him."
